Burj sabah
Burj Sabah, a 24-storey residential tower developed by RSG International and completed in 2020 in Jumeirah Village Circle (District 12), features a selection of stylish studios, 1-bedroom, and 2-bedroom apartments known for their Arabic/Mediterranean-inspired design, spacious balconies, and well-finished interiors. Situated in a tranquil, landscaped community with excellent connectivity to Al Khail and Sheikh Mohammed bin Zayed Roads, residents enjoy upscale amenities including a swimming pool, gym, landscaped gardens, covered designated parking, and 24/7 security. The tower comprises 228 residential units and stands out for its thoughtful orientation, quality construction, and harmony with its surroundings.

- Is Burj sabah a good place to rent in Jumeirah Village Circle?
- 1-bedrooms in JVC run AED 55,000–90,000/year in 2026 — the best value per square metre in central Dubai. Studios from AED 35,000. No Metro. Traffic at peak hours toward SZR is the top complaint. - Is JVC a good place to live in Dubai?
- For the value, yes. JVC has matured significantly since 2020 — supermarkets, nurseries, gyms, and cafes are now well-established. The commute without a car is impractical, but with a car JVC puts you 15–20 minutes from most Dubai work hubs.
- How much does it cost to rent at Burj sabah in Jumeirah Village Circle?
- Studios from AED 35,000/year, 1-bedrooms AED 55,000–90,000, 2-bedrooms AED 80,000–130,000, 3-bedrooms AED 110,000–160,000. JVC consistently offers the most space per dirham of any mid-central Dubai community.
